What exactly does three sides mean?
Three-body suit is a technical term of clothing, which refers to clothes with one-third of the bust cut, usually including suits, Zhongshan suits, student clothes, various uniforms and other formal clothes.

Specifically, the three-piece suit of clothing is divided into two front pieces and one back piece (although the suit has a middle seam, it is still one piece), and the width of each piece is close to one third of the total fatness of the clothing. This design can create a slim effect and is suitable for formal occasions.

In contrast, a four-piece suit means that the width of a garment piece accounts for about a quarter of the bust, and it is often used in some loose or casual clothes, such as shirts, jackets and coats. The feature of four-piece clothing is that the front and back pieces have obvious dividing lines, which visually presents a more relaxed and comfortable effect.

It should be noted that different clothing brands and styles may be different, and the specific cutting methods and design details may be different.
